BILT is a peer learning platform for TVET providers in Africa, Asia-Pacific and Europe. It helps them address current challenges in TVET systems arising from technological, social, environmental and workplace changes.

BILT themes

New Qualifications and Competencies

New Qualifications and Competencies (NQC) is the overarching theme of the BILT project. The project explores how they can be put into practice, ensuring future-oriented, attractive TVET career paths.

Learn more about the NQC framework


Within the framework of new qualifications and competencies, BILT addresses four thematic areas that TVET institutions collectively engage with:

Digitalization

Providing response to new skills demands, as technology has permeated the world of work and is changing the profile of jobs

Read more


Greening

Responding to new development paradigms for sustainability and reduced environmental impact

Read more

Migration

Accelerating the integration of migrants into their host communities, and allowing them to become productive members of the workforce

Read more

Entrepreneurship

Unlocking the potential of innovative entrepreneurial activities and fostering entrepreneurial culture.
